2 Amazing Hot and Cold Water Density Experiments
The science will amaze you if you just look close enough to things that surround you. What do you think would happen if you put hot and cold water in one container without mixing? Would "hot-air-balloon" principle work underwater where we heat water instead of air? We have done two cool experiments to answer those questions.
Water changes density depending on the temperature. So much so that cold water would not mix with hot water if you place it carefully in one container. The molecules in hot water are excited by the energy, and they move faster. So when they bump into one another, they bounce further away, leaving big gaps. This means that now the same volume of water has fewer molecules and weights less. The opposite happens with cold water making its density a bit higher.
Although the density difference is not that great, we can still see how hot water floats at the top while cold water stays at the bottom in our experiments. And this slight density difference has a significant impact on natural phenomena such as ocean currents.
